Drop Us a Query:
We offer Best Android Training in Mohali
Android is an Operating System designed for smartphones and mobiles. It is largely used mobile operating system and around 70% of professional mobile application developers develops applications for this platform.
Course Objective
- Learn Basic JAVA Concepts
- Learn Android Concepts
- Learn to Create Android Application
Why Join Ingenimos for Android Training?
Android is most used Operating system for mobiles and currently Google has introduced it to Android TV, wearable devices and even Android Cars. According to a survey 40% of professional developers see Android as their primary target Operating System platform.
Ingenimos have expert android developers who can convert a novice student to a professional android developer.
After you become and Android Developer, you will have much scope in the job and you can also create your own android applications as a freelancer.
Other Benefits
We provide 100% job assistance with the android training course. So students joining this course will have better job opportunities.
-
Basic Java
- Basic Java Concepts
- OOPS concepts
- Programming with JAVA
-
Overview of Android
- Overview of the Android Platform
- Android User Interface
- Android Architecture
- Role of Java
-
Android SDK
- Eclipse IDE Plugin
- Device Emulator
- Profiling Tools
- Sample Application
- Application fundamentals & user interface
-
Android Application Fundamentals
- Android application building block
- Activating components
- Life Cycle of Application
- Development tools, Manifest File
- Life Cycle of Activity
-
Basic UI Design
- Form widgets
- Text Fields
- Layouts
-
- Relative Layout
- Table Layout
- Frame Layout
- Linear Layout
- Nested Layout
-
Menus
- Option Menu
- Context Menu
- Sub Menu
- Menu from XML
- Menu via code
-
Main Building Blocks
- Activity
- Intents
- Services
- Content Providers
- Broadcast Receivers
- Location based services
- Sensors
- Camera
-
Data Storage
- Shared Preferences
- Internal Storage (Files)
- External Storage(SD Card)
- SQLite Databases
-
SQLite Programming
- Introduction to SQLite
- SQL Basics
- Database Connectivity
- Data binding
- Using content provider
- Implementing content provider
-
Publishing Applications
- Testing application
- Signing the application
- Versioning application
- Publishing in android market
Is there any prerequisite for Learning Android?
Yes, Prior Programming knowledge is mandatory. Also you should be well versed with OOP Concepts and Basic JAVA.